
Achraf Hafedh contributed to the ovh/manager repository by delivering four features over two months, focusing on code quality, maintainability, and security. He migrated static analysis to a modern ESLint configuration across multiple packages, progressively adopting new rules and deprecating legacy ones to reduce technical debt and standardize code practices. Achraf also developed a Domain Services Resiliation Modal, updating related release processes and addressing dependency issues. Additionally, he implemented integration tests for MFA enrollment, validating UI rendering and routing logic. His work utilized JavaScript, TypeScript, and React, demonstrating depth in frontend development, configuration management, and automated testing practices.

October 2025: Delivered key features and fixes for ovh/manager with a focus on code quality, UI improvements, and validation of security-related flows. Achievements include migrating static analysis to a new ESLint configuration across hub and procedures, implementing a Domain Services Resiliation Modal with related release updates and a fix for missing billing logs dependencies, and adding MFA enrollment integration tests to validate rendering, visibility logic, and routing in the container app. These efforts improve static analysis coverage, release quality, and end-user security workflows while sharpening the team's technical capabilities.
October 2025: Delivered key features and fixes for ovh/manager with a focus on code quality, UI improvements, and validation of security-related flows. Achievements include migrating static analysis to a new ESLint configuration across hub and procedures, implementing a Domain Services Resiliation Modal with related release updates and a fix for missing billing logs dependencies, and adding MFA enrollment integration tests to validate rendering, visibility logic, and routing in the container app. These efforts improve static analysis coverage, release quality, and end-user security workflows while sharpening the team's technical capabilities.
September 2025: Delivered ESLint Configuration Migration for Catalog Package in ovh/manager. Migrated to a modern ESLint configuration, progressively adopting new rules and deprecating legacy ones to improve code quality, consistency, and maintainability. The change reduces technical debt and lays the groundwork for safer CI and faster onboarding across the Catalog code paths.
September 2025: Delivered ESLint Configuration Migration for Catalog Package in ovh/manager. Migrated to a modern ESLint configuration, progressively adopting new rules and deprecating legacy ones to improve code quality, consistency, and maintainability. The change reduces technical debt and lays the groundwork for safer CI and faster onboarding across the Catalog code paths.
Overview of all repositories you've contributed to across your timeline